This past weekend Josh traveled to Hershey to compete at the PIAA Cross Country Championships. In his second trip, he was looking to bring home a medal, and he did just that. In a field of 272 of the top Single A runners in the state, Josh finished 19th with a time of 17:18! Josh is also the first Union City boys to medal at states in 21 years. Congratulations Josh!

Did you know that UCASD is the proud recipient of a Pennsylvania Broadband Development Authority Grant?! The goal of the program, entitled ConnectUC, is to bring access to technology to support digital literacy and occupational skills training opportunities. Through this grant, we are are able to offer three different programs to the community: 1) A Laptop Borrowing Program for Community Members, 2) A Digital Literacy Event Series for Community Members, and 3) Open Lab Nights for Community Members. Greetings, Bears! We are sharing our 2025-2026 UCASD School Assessment Calendar. This calendar highlights each of the testing dates for our Winter and Spring Keystone Exams for high school students and our Spring PSSAs for elementary and middle school. The image includes details on which grade-levels and content areas are tested and which Keystone exams are taken when. We also have a host of resources and information for families posted on our Student Assessment page on our District Website. Please feel free to check it out and know that you are always welcome to reach out to your child's guidance counselor and School Assessment Coordinator, Mr. McMahan, Mr. Anthony, and/or Mrs. Conti, or our District Assessment Coordinator, Mrs. Dell, with any questions throughout the year. We will host informational sessions for parents/guardians later this year and will also be sure to send reminders out as we get closer to each testing window.
